Think about all this other little stuff, other than the weight for a second:
CX/DX have tiny brakes. Even 14's make them look little.
CX/DX in white, will have a blue dash/interior.
It will not have swaybar mounting points.
Nothing will be wired up, except tach, which you still need from an EX.
Even if you stay SOHC, and do a VTEC head, you will STILL need to replace the transmission. DX is long, and CX super long, and will top out 120+ in only 3rd gear. Still needs a Z6/Y8 tranny.
